Abstract

Algal interactions with physicochemical parameters of some manmade freshwater ponds have been studied. Algal species and their correlation with physicochemical parameters in some manmade ponds were correlated. Algae and water samples were collected, preserved and analyzed using standard methods. Closterium sp. and Rhizoclonium hookeri Kuetz. were positively associated with the concentration of Fe, however they were negatively correlated (sensitive) to alkalinity, total dissolved solids and electrical conductivity. Stichococcus bacillaris , Naegeli, Staurastrum rotula Nordst. and Sphaeroplea sp. had significant positive correlation with biochemical oxygen demand (BOD), Mn, and Mo levels in the water. Pseudouvella americana (snow) Wille. and Scenedesmus quadricauda (Turp.) de Breb. showed a close positive correlation with alkalinity but were sensitive to Fe, BOD, Mn and Mo. The species reported here showed closed correlation with physicochemical factors in these freshwater ponds in Karauli.
